Output 8762367fba93336099779d37135bd908a67c6cdd6047b80f23237f66090c1e97:1

value
21253053
script pubkey
OP_0 OP_PUSHBYTES_20 0387d14eb6b28b01255ce0939cc50918e33d0e79
address
bc1qqwrazn4kk29szf2uuzfee3gfrr3n6rnevj9z0a
transaction
8762367fba93336099779d37135bd908a67c6cdd6047b80f23237f66090c1e97